What Is a Bail Bond?
Let’s break it down in the simplest way possible.
When someone is arrested, a judge sets a bail amount—an amount of money that allows the person to stay out of jail while they wait for their court date. If you pay the full bail in cash, your loved one can be released almost immediately.
But here’s the thing: most bail amounts are thousands of dollars. Not many people have that kind of cash sitting around.
That’s where Boulder bail bonds come in. A bail bond is a service where you pay a small portion of the total bail (usually 10%), and a licensed bondsman posts the full amount with the court.
This allows your loved one to be released without you needing to come up with the full bail amount on your own.

What Happens After They’re Released?
Once your loved one is out on bail, they’ll be expected to attend their court dates and follow any conditions the judge sets. They do that, the process runs smoothly.
If you’re the co-signer, you’re promising they’ll follow the rules. If they don’t, the bail can be revoked—and you could be on the hook for the full amount.
